Abstract
A directional gate type block valve includes a valve body, a gate type straddle, a transmission stem and four seats for process fluid sealing, wherein the transmission stem drives the gate type straddle allowing 3 position options for gate type straddle, directing or even completely sealing the system. This directional gate type block valve provides the exploration system the simplification of using only one equipment for directing the process fluid, besides allowing its use in a wide range of permissible working pressures. Other advantages due to its simple geometry are given by the low cost of manufacture, assembly and test of the directional gate type block valve.
Claims
1. A directional gate type block valve comprising a valve body, a gate type straddle, a transmission stem and four seats for process fluid sealing.
2.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ein the directional gate type block valve provides its use for only one subsea equipment.
3.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ein the transmission stem drives the gate type straddle for allowing three positions settings of the gate type straddle.
4.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ein the first position option of the gate type straddle allows a fluid path in a first channel, leaving a second channel tight.
5.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ein a second position option of the gate type straddle allows a fluid path in a second channel, leaving a first channel tight.
6.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ein a third position option of the gate type straddle allows stagnation of a first channel and a second channel and, achieving total sealing of the system.
7.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ein the directional gate type block valve is applicable in subsea equipment to direct the process fluids, as well as provide a total sealing.
8. The directional gate type block valve, according to claim 1, wherein the directional gate type block valve works in deep waters, about up to 3000 m.

[0023] Thus, according to the exposed above, it will be clear to any person skilled in the art the new conception advantages of the directional gate type block valve (10) object of the present invention. Among these advantages, we may mention the subsea systems, simplification due to the use of only one equipment for directing the process fluid, where generally two or more equipment would be used. Further, we also may mention that for sealing effects, the directional gate type block valve (10) may be used for working with low pressures, lower than 300 psi, or high pressures that may reach up to 10000 psi, besides allowing an increased amount of operation cycles and lifetime compatible with the minimum requirements for use in subsea oil fields or deep water work, such as those up to 3000 m.
[0024] The directional gate type block valve (10), according to the present invention, was designed for use in subsea equipment, however, considering the numerous technical and economic advantages offered by it, and the wide range of permissible operating pressures, this would not be the only possible application and could be extended to any system that requires fluid sealing and directing, either on the surface or below the water slide, in the oil and gas area or in any engineering field.
